In 2021, Collins, IA had a population of 431 people with a median age of 39.8 and a median household income of $65,417. Between 2020 and 2021 the population of Collins, IA declined from 444 to 431, a −2.93% decrease and its median household income grew from $61,442 to $65,417, a 6.47% increase.
The 5 largest ethnic groups in Collins, IA are White (Non-Hispanic) (92.8%), Two+ (Hispanic) (3.48%), Two+ (Non-Hispanic) (2.32%), White (Hispanic) (0.464%), and Black or African American (Non-Hispanic) (0.464%).
None of the households in Collins, IA reported speaking a non-English language at home as their primary shared language. This does not consider the potential multi-lingual nature of households, but only the primary self-reported language spoken by all members of the household.
100% of the residents in Collins, IA are U.S. citizens.
In 2021, the median property value in Collins, IA was $91,700, and the homeownership rate was 68.1%.
Most people in Collins, IA drove alone to work, and the average commute time was 29.8 minutes. The average car ownership in Collins, IA was 2 cars per household.
